Base model Adriatic Green Fairlane, not even a Fairlane 500. Broken manual steering horn ring,  manual brake pedal, 2 speed Fordomatic. Push button radio- manual tune was available. Padded dash was an option, this is base metal. Polar Air. Full Sundial wheel covers. Can't see if it has a choke knob, steering wheel in the way. If so, 223" six. If not, probably a YBlock V8.

The seats look as if they've been recovered, carpet replaced the original rubber floor mats.

Also missing the aluminum bright-dip molding on the bottom of the gas door.
